There's an interesting, albeit long, article by Schreier about the development process of Anthem and what a fucking mess it was that led to the disappointing end product: http://archive.is/jPKaV

The main takeaway is that they didn't know what they wanted to make, that the game changed a lot during development but for years never had a clear vision.
Loads of people left BioWare, resources between the three BioWare studios were juggled, creating even more of a mess and lack of vision.
Frostbite was a pain in the ass to work with.
The current version of Anthem was made in the last 12 to 18 months. Destiny was a forbidden word in the office.
BioWare leadership thought until the very end that stuff will just magically work out because that's supposedly how it works at BioWare. Didn't work for ME:Andromeda either.
The only fault EA had is forcing Frostbite on all it's studios and having the special Frostbite help team manly focused on helping out the studio that makes FIFA, taking time away for them to help other studios that struggled with the engine.

A really interesting read and especially concerning in how similar it is to the development of Destiny 1&2.
